Amsterdam, The Netherlands – Royal Philips Electronics (AEX: PHI, NYSE: PHG) today announced it has sold 24 million shares of common stock in LG Display Co., Ltd. (NYSE: LPL, KRX: 034220) to investors in a capital markets transaction. This transaction represents 6.7% of LG Display’s issued share capital and reduces Philips’ holding to 13.2%.

SUSE (pronounced /ˈsuːsə/[1], German: IPA: [ˈzuːzə]) is a major retail Linux distribution, produced in Germany and owned by Novell, Inc. SUSE is also a founding member of the Desktop Linux Consortium.
As of version 10.2 Alpha 3, the distribution is officially named openSUSE.
History
The SUSE Linux distribution was originally a German translation of Slackware Linux. The Slackware distribution (maintained by Patrick Volkerding) was initially based largely on SLS.
